IT & Networking

Optimize Enterprise Data Distribution Systems

In the modern digital landscape, the ability to move vast quantities of information quickly and securely is the cornerstone of operational success. Enterprise data distribution systems serve as the nervous system of large organizations, ensuring that critical insights reach the right stakeholders and applications at the precise moment they are needed. As data volumes continue to explode, understanding how to leverage these systems is essential for maintaining a competitive edge.

Understanding Enterprise Data Distribution Systems

Enterprise data distribution systems are comprehensive frameworks designed to manage the dissemination of data across an organization’s various departments, geographical locations, and software ecosystems. These systems act as a centralized hub for routing information from diverse sources to multiple destinations, ensuring consistency and reliability throughout the process.

At their core, these systems solve the problem of data silos by creating a unified path for information flow. By implementing robust enterprise data distribution systems, companies can automate the delivery of real-time analytics, financial reports, and operational updates without manual intervention.

Key Components of Data Distribution

To function effectively, enterprise data distribution systems rely on several integrated components. These include data ingestion engines, transformation layers, and delivery protocols that work in tandem to maintain data integrity.

  • Data Ingestion: The process of collecting information from various sources like IoT devices, databases, and third-party APIs.
  • Message Queuing: A mechanism that manages the flow of data packets to prevent system overloads during peak traffic.
  • Data Transformation: Converting raw data into a standardized format that is compatible with receiving applications.
  • Security Protocols: Encryption and authentication measures that protect sensitive information during transit.

The Strategic Value of Efficient Distribution

Implementing enterprise data distribution systems offers more than just technical convenience; it provides a strategic advantage that impacts the entire business model. When data moves fluidly, decision-makers can react to market changes with unprecedented speed.

Efficiency in data distribution reduces the latency between an event occurring and the subsequent business response. For example, in the financial sector, enterprise data distribution systems allow for the instantaneous sharing of market fluctuations across global trading floors, enabling rapid execution of high-stakes transactions.

Enhancing Operational Scalability

As organizations grow, their data needs evolve in complexity and volume. Enterprise data distribution systems are built to scale, allowing for the addition of new data sources and endpoints without disrupting existing workflows.

This scalability ensures that the infrastructure remains resilient even as the company expands into new markets or adopts new technologies. By decoupling data producers from data consumers, these systems provide the flexibility needed to upgrade individual components of the IT stack independently.

Architectural Patterns in Data Distribution

Choosing the right architecture is critical when deploying enterprise data distribution systems. Different business needs require different approaches to how data is routed and stored during the distribution process.

Publish-Subscribe (Pub/Sub) Models

The Pub/Sub model is a popular choice for enterprise data distribution systems requiring real-time updates. In this setup, data producers “publish” messages to specific topics, and any interested applications “subscribe” to those topics to receive the information.

This pattern is highly effective for broadcasting information to a wide range of recipients simultaneously. It ensures that the sender does not need to know who the recipients are, which simplifies the overall system architecture.

Point-to-Point Distribution

For more sensitive or specific data transfers, point-to-point models are often utilized within enterprise data distribution systems. This ensures that data is sent directly from one source to one specific destination, providing a clear audit trail and tighter control over data access.

This approach is frequently seen in payroll processing or legal document transfers where privacy and direct delivery are the highest priorities. It minimizes the risk of unauthorized interception by limiting the number of nodes the data passes through.

Overcoming Common Challenges

While enterprise data distribution systems offer significant benefits, they also present unique challenges that must be addressed during the planning and implementation phases. Managing data consistency and system downtime are among the primary concerns for IT administrators.

Ensuring data consistency across multiple global nodes can be difficult, especially when network latency varies between regions. Modern enterprise data distribution systems use sophisticated synchronization algorithms to ensure that every endpoint has access to the most recent and accurate version of the data.

Maintaining High Availability

System downtime can lead to significant financial losses and operational paralysis. To mitigate this risk, enterprise data distribution systems incorporate redundancy and failover mechanisms.

By distributing data across multiple servers and geographic zones, organizations can ensure that the system remains functional even if a specific hardware component or network link fails. This high-availability approach is a hallmark of enterprise-grade solutions.

Best Practices for Implementation

Successfully deploying enterprise data distribution systems requires a clear strategy and adherence to industry best practices. Organizations should begin by auditing their current data landscape to identify bottlenecks and security vulnerabilities.

  • Define Clear Objectives: Understand exactly what the system needs to achieve, whether it is reducing latency or improving data compliance.
  • Prioritize Security: Implement end-to-end encryption and robust access controls from the very beginning.
  • Monitor Performance: Use real-time monitoring tools to track the health of the distribution network and identify issues before they impact the business.
  • Invest in Training: Ensure that the IT staff is well-versed in the specific technologies used within the enterprise data distribution systems.

Future-Proofing Your Data Strategy

The technology surrounding enterprise data distribution systems is constantly evolving. Future-proofing involves selecting modular solutions that can integrate with emerging technologies like artificial intelligence and machine learning.

As AI becomes more prevalent, the demand for high-quality, real-time data will only increase. Robust enterprise data distribution systems will be the primary drivers behind successful AI implementations, providing the clean and timely data required for advanced model training.

Conclusion

Enterprise data distribution systems are no longer a luxury for large corporations; they are a fundamental necessity in a data-driven world. By centralizing and streamlining the flow of information, these systems enable organizations to operate with greater agility, security, and efficiency.

To stay ahead in your industry, evaluate your current data infrastructure and consider how modern enterprise data distribution systems can transform your operations. Start by identifying your most critical data flows and exploring the architectural models that best suit your organizational goals. Investing in a robust distribution framework today will provide the foundation for your success tomorrow.